FACT SHEET FOR S.B. 1250

 

watercraft; towing companies; notice

 

Purpose     

 

Allows the Arizona Game and Fish Department to release watercraft registration information to towing companies in possession of an unidentified watercraft for the purpose of notifying the owners and lien holders of their intent to sell the watercraft.  Allows the Department to transfer ownership of abandoned watercrafts to a towing company.

 

Background

 

The Arizona Game and Fish Department (Department) can divulge information from a watercraft registration record only if the person requesting the information knows the name of the owner, the hull identification number and the Department-issued number assigned to the watercraft.  Some persons and agencies are exempt from these requirements, including state and federal agencies or courts, officers of the law, certain financial institutions, private investigators and attorneys.  However, in the case of an abandoned watercraft at a towing company, the Department is unable to divulge ownership information.

 

S.B. 1250 establishes the requirements for notifying watercraft owners and lien holders that a towing company is in possession of their watercraft.  The bill also establishes transfer of ownership procedures for both the Department and the towing company if no authorized persons come forward to claim the watercraft.  There is no known fiscal impact to the state general fund relating to the provisions of this bill.

 

Provisions

 

Towing Company Responsibilities

 

1.      Requires a towing company that tows a watercraft to obtain watercraft registration information from the Department and to notify the owners and lien holders of the watercraft’s location.

 

2.      Requires the towing company to submit a report to the Directors of the Department of Public Safety and the Arizona Game and Fish Department if the watercraft is not claimed within ten days after notifying the owner and lien holders of the watercraft’s location.

 

3.      Requires the towing company to notify the Department within 24 hours if the watercraft is claimed by the owners or lien holders.

  


Notification Process and Transfer of Ownership

 

4.      Allows the Department to supply watercraft registration information to towing companies that possess an unidentified watercraft and intend to notify the owners and lien holders of the watercraft of the company’s intent to sell the watercraft.

 

5.      Requires the Department, upon receipt of a report by a towing company of an unclaimed watercraft, to determine the names of the owners and lien holders and notify all interested parties by mail. Stipulates that the notice must be mailed within 5 days for watercrafts with in-state records and 30 days for all other watercrafts.

 

6.      Stipulates that if the Department is unable to determine the names of the owners and lien holders, the Department must publish a notice of its intent to transfer ownership of the watercraft in a newspaper of general circulation in the county in which the watercraft was towed.

 

7.      Stipulates that if the watercraft remains unclaimed 30 days after the notice was mailed to the owners and lien holders or ten days after the notice was published in the newspaper, the Director must determine if the watercraft is stolen.

 

8.      Allows the Director, upon receiving notification that the watercraft is not stolen, to transfer ownership of the watercraft to the towing company free and clear of all liens or encumbrances.

 

9.      Requires the towing company, in order for ownership of the watercraft to be transferred, to certify that it is in possession of the watercraft and that no person has entered into an agreement for the release or return of the watercraft.

 

Liability

 

10.  Removes liability from the state, its agencies and employees for relying in good faith upon the contents of the reports and affidavits.

 

11.  Removes liability from the towing company for obtaining a transfer of ownership if the towing company complies with the requirements of this article.
